MANSFIELD, Mass. - Sophomore Magdalena Hubickova (Prague, Czech Republic) was selected as the Northeast-10 Vern Cox Women's Tennis Player of the Year on Tuesday, as the league office announced its all-conference awards.
Hubickova is the fourth Penmen in program history to earn the honor and the first since Abla Chadli in 2016. With eligibility remaining, she will also be able to join Amber Chandronnait (2009, 2010, 2011) and Alena Mukdaprakorn (2012, 2013) as multiple-time winner of the award. Hubickova, who was also named to the NE10 All-Conference First Team, is 8-1 so far this season, all at the top flight. Hubickova was the league's Rookie of the Year, as well as a Second Teamer at No. 1 singles, a year ago.
Junior Alexxa Etienne (Bayamon, Puerto Rico) earned a spot on the Second Team at No. 2 singles, where she also is 8-1 on the year. Etienne was the 2018-19 NE10 Rookie of the Year and a First Team honoree at No. 3 singles that year.
Sophomore Isabella Andrade (Cochabama, Bolivia) was a Third Team honoree at No. 3 singles. She is 8-1 on the season, including 4-1 at No. 3. Andrade was a First Team pick at No. 5 singles last season.
Freshman Madison Blazejowski (Wethersfield, Conn.) collected a Third Team accolades, and also received an All-Rookie Team nod, after going 2-0 early on before having her season cut short due to injury.
In doubles, Hubickova and Etienne were chosen as a First Team duo at No. 1 for the second consecutive season. They are 7-2 this season, all at the top flight.
The fifth-seeded Penmen will take on fourth-seeded Le Moyne College in an NE10 Championship quarterfinal match Wednesday (April 28) at 1 p.m.
